Debian changelog:

 libgpod (0.6.0-6) unstable; urgency=low

   * Use dh_lintian to install lintian overrides
     + Increase debhelper build-dep to >= 6.0.7
   * Increase debhelper compat level to 6
   * Move documentation and examples from libgpod-common to
     libgpod-doc, so that people who don't need that don't
     get it automatically via the Recommends of libgpod-common
     by libgpod3. Add a Suggests on the new package from the
     -dev packages. (Closes: #486382).
   * Further reduce unnecessary duplication by removing the -dev
     packages' usr/share/doc directories in favor of symlinks
     to the corresponding directories in the library packages.
     The already have a '=' dependency anyway.
   * 25_xsltproc-nonet: New patch to add a -nonet argument to
     the xsltproc call. Which shows that a build-dependency
     on docbook-xml was missing.
   * Previously all packages used the same short description
     which was somewhat confusing. Try to disambiguate this.

 -- Frank Lichtenheld <email address hidden> Sun, 29 Jun 2008 01:29:38
